Height 24 cm depth 46 cm width across the front 41cm. Will be tight but should fit as long as the other dimensions are also acceptable. Great machine with good quality prints even when using none standard laser ink purchased via amazon.

I've printed up to 180gsm card with no problem provided the setting is for thicker paper in the Properties set up. However, it does not like coated card - the ink will smudge over the edges for some reason. This does not happen with an ink jet.
